Skip to content

PPrint compile error on Any #306

@lihaoyi

Description

@lihaoyi

For some reason, Any blows up but AnyRef seems fine

haoyi-Ammonite@ ??? : Any
Compilation Failed
Main.scala:153: diverging implicit expansion for type pprint.PPrinter[A]
starting with method pathRepr in object PPrints
              .print(res2, res2, "res2", scala.None)
                    ^
haoyi-Ammonite@ ??? : AnyRef
scala.NotImplementedError: an implementation is missing
    scala.Predef$.$qmark$qmark$qmark(Predef.scala:225)
    cmd2$.<init>(Main.scala:140)
    cmd2$.<clinit>(Main.scala:-1)

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ions